Snarky

Snarky adjective - Marked by the use of wit that is intended to cause hurt feelings.
Usage example: with champagne as a lubricant, she unleashed an unending series of snarky comments for the duration of the wedding reception

Smart-mouthed and snarky are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Smart-mouthed" instead an adjective "Snarky".
